
Precision Compressor/Limiter from IK multimedia Recreation of Neve 33609 stereo compressor/limiter available on T-RackS CS
T-RackS Custom Shop Precision Compressor/LimiterIK Multimedia, makers of the popular T-RackS plug-ins have released their take on the classic Neve 33609 stereo compressor/limiter. Available in 32-bit and 64-bit AAX, Audio Unit, VST and RTAS, so you shouldnt have any problems running it on the latest versions of your favourite DAW.
The plug-in costs 100 credits, so depending on the size of the credit pack you buy in the IK T-RackS store, it should cost between 40 and 80.

New Precision Compressor/Limiter
T-RackS Custom Shop 4.2 adds a longtime studio favourite piece of gear: the Precision Compressor/Limiter. This gear model is based on a classic 1970s solid-state compressor/limiter unit thats been the must-have compressor/limiter in studios worldwide for over 40 years. The Precision model imparts a warm fat and thick sonic character, but isnt overly aggressive, even at higher compression ratios. The result is a very transparent yet musical sound that doesnt lose focus or detail, and is perfectly suited for virtually any mastering, post-production or broadcast application.
The Precision Compressor/Limiter features two main sections, the Compressor and the Limiter. The Compressor section has a fixed attack time (which is influenced in part by the selected ratio) and the release time can be selected from 6 values, two of which are automatic and dependent upon the audio material. The Limiter features a switchable slow/fast attack setting, a fixed ratio and adjustable recovery time. The limited control is extremely easy to use, and makes it possible for users to achieve high-quality results in a short amount of time.
About the T-RackS Custom Shop
IK Multimedia pioneered analogue modelling in 1999 with the original version of T-RackS, the first desktop-mastering-software suite, and has been at the forefront of developing mixing-and-mastering software ever since. The T-RackS Custom Shop features a growing array of vintage and modern processing effects and modules that add the perfect touch to virtually every style of music. Its flexible module-based architecture lets users configure the chain of mastering effects quickly and easily, and save configurations as presets for instant recall. T-RackS processors can be used on individual channel strips for mixing applications in a DAW, on the master fader or AUX faders, or as a standalone mastering station for final polish.
T-RackS Custom Shop is IKs innovative shopping platform that allows users to try and buy individual processors any time from the comfort of their own studio. All T-RackS processors can be demoed for a period of 2 days, and purchased one at a time right from the Custom Shop. T-RackS Custom Shop software is free, and can be downloaded from the IK Multimedia web site.
